Frenuloplasty – Relief from Penile Frenulum Discomfort at Minnerva Clinic
The penile frenulum is the small, elastic band of tissue that connects the foreskin to the glans (head) on the underside of the penis. In some men, this frenulum can be unusually short or tight, a condition known as frenulum breve. This can lead to discomfort, pain, or even tearing during sexual activity or when the foreskin is retracted. Frenuloplasty is a minor surgical procedure designed to lengthen or release this tight frenulum, alleviating these symptoms and improving comfort and function. Understanding Frenulum Breve (Short/Tight Frenulum) & How Frenuloplasty Offers Effective Relief
Frenulum breve, or a short penile frenulum, can cause several issues:
- Pain or Discomfort: During erection or sexual intercourse, as the tight frenulum is stretched.
- Downward Curvature of the Glans: The tight frenulum can pull the head of the penis downwards, especially during erection.
- Tearing of the Frenulum: The frenulum can tear during sexual activity, leading to bleeding and pain, and subsequent scarring can sometimes worsen the tightness.
- Difficulty Retracting the Foreskin Fully: In uncircumcised men, a tight frenulum can contribute to difficulty in fully retracting the foreskin.
- Premature Ejaculation (in some cases): Overstimulation or discomfort from a tight frenulum is sometimes thought to contribute to premature ejaculation in certain individuals.
How Frenuloplasty Works:
Frenuloplasty is a straightforward surgical procedure aimed at releasing the tension in a short or tight frenulum. The common techniques involve:
- Anesthesia: The procedure is typically performed under local anesthesia (numbing injections at the base of the penis or topical numbing cream applied to the frenulum area). General anesthesia or sedation is rarely needed but can be an option.
- Preparation: The penis and surrounding area are cleansed with an antiseptic solution.
- Frenulum Release/Lengthening:
- Frenotomy with Transverse Closure (Most Common): The surgeon makes a precise horizontal cut (frenotomy) across the tight band of the frenulum, releasing the tension. The resulting diamond-shaped defect is then carefully stitched together vertically (transversely to the original cut). This technique effectively lengthens the frenulum.
- Z-Plasty or V-Y Plasty: More complex flap techniques may be used in some cases to achieve greater lengthening or address specific scarring.
- Suture Closure: Fine, absorbable sutures are typically used to close the incision. These sutures dissolve on their own over a few weeks and do not usually require removal.
- Dressing (Optional): A small amount of antibiotic ointment may be applied. A dressing is not always necessary.

Frenuloplasty Results & Aftercare: Enjoy Lasting Comfort and Improved Function
Seeing Your Results:
You will notice an immediate release of tension in the frenulum right after the procedure, although there will be some initial swelling and tenderness. As these subside over the first week or two, and as the sutures dissolve, you will experience the full benefits of the frenuloplasty. This includes relief from pain or pulling during erections and sexual activity, and potentially easier foreskin retraction if that was an issue. The small scar from the procedure will typically heal very well and become inconspicuous over time.
How Long Do Results Last?
The results of frenuloplasty are generally permanent. The surgical lengthening or release of the frenulum provides a lasting solution to the problems caused by frenulum breve. The frenulum should not become tight again unless there is significant new scarring from an unrelated injury.
Essential Aftercare:
- Keep the Area Clean: Gently clean the area daily with mild soap and water, or as instructed by your surgeon. Pat dry carefully.
- Apply Ointment (if prescribed): Use any prescribed antibiotic or healing ointment as directed.
- Manage Discomfort: Mild pain or tenderness can usually be managed with over-the-counter pain relievers like paracetamol or ibuprofen.
- Wear Loose-Fitting Underwear: This can help improve comfort and reduce friction on the healing area.
- Avoid Sexual Activity & Masturbation: Refrain from any sexual activity, including masturbation, for about 3-4 weeks, or until your surgeon advises that the area is fully healed and comfortable. This is crucial to prevent straining the suture line and allow proper healing.
- Monitor for Healing: Watch for signs of infection (increasing redness, swelling, warmth, pus, fever) or excessive bleeding, and contact the clinic if you have any concerns.
- Suture Dissolution: Absorbable sutures will gradually dissolve on their own over 1-3 weeks. Do not try to remove them.
